# 如何评估攻击数据分析对业务的影响?
## 引言
随着信息技术的迅猛发展,网络安全问题日益突出。攻击数据分析作为网络安全的重要组成部分,其效果直接影响到业务的稳定性和安全性。如何科学、系统地评估攻击数据分析对业务的影响,成为企业和组织亟待解决的问题。本文将结合AI技术在网络安全领域的应用场景,详细探讨评估攻击数据分析对业务影响的方法和策略。
## 一、攻击数据分析概述
### 1.1 攻击数据分析的定义
攻击数据分析是指通过对网络攻击行为的相关数据进行收集、处理、分析和解释,以识别攻击模式、预测攻击趋势、评估攻击影响的过程。其目的是为了更好地防御和应对网络攻击,保障业务的正常运行。
### 1.2 攻击数据分析的重要性
- **提高防御能力**:通过分析攻击数据,可以发现潜在的攻击模式和漏洞,从而提前采取防御措施。
- **减少损失**:及时识别和应对攻击,可以减少因攻击导致的业务中断和经济损失。
- **优化资源配置**:根据攻击数据分析结果,可以合理配置安全资源,提高安全投资的回报率。
## 二、AI技术在攻击数据分析中的应用
### 2.1 数据收集与预处理
#### 2.1.1 数据收集
AI技术可以通过自动化工具和传感器,实时收集网络流量、日志文件、系统状态等多种数据。例如,使用深度包检测(DPI)技术,可以捕获和分析网络数据包,提取有价值的信息。
#### 2.1.2 数据预处理
AI技术可以对收集到的数据进行清洗、归一化和特征提取,去除噪声和冗余信息,提高数据质量。例如,使用机器学习算法对数据进行聚类和分类,提取出与攻击行为相关的关键特征。
### 2.2 攻击模式识别
#### 2.2.1 异常检测
AI技术可以通过异常检测算法,识别出与正常行为显著不同的异常行为。例如,使用基于统计的异常检测方法,可以识别出流量突增、异常访问等潜在攻击行为。
#### 2.2.2 模式匹配
AI技术可以通过模式匹配算法,识别出已知的攻击模式。例如,使用深度学习中的卷积神经网络(CNN),可以识别出特定的攻击签名和行为模式。
### 2.3 攻击趋势预测
#### 2.3.1 时间序列分析
AI技术可以通过时间序列分析方法,预测攻击趋势。例如,使用长短期记忆网络(LSTM),可以基于历史攻击数据,预测未来一段时间内的攻击趋势。
#### 2.3.2 关联规则挖掘
AI技术可以通过关联规则挖掘,发现不同攻击行为之间的关联性。例如,使用Apriori算法,可以发现某些攻击行为的高频组合,从而预测潜在的复合攻击。
## 三、评估攻击数据分析对业务的影响
### 3.1 影响评估指标
#### 3.1.1 业务中断时间
业务中断时间是评估攻击影响的重要指标。通过分析攻击数据,可以估算出攻击导致的业务中断时间,从而评估对业务连续性的影响。
#### 3.1.2 经济损失
经济损失包括直接损失和间接损失。直接损失如数据泄露、设备损坏等,间接损失如声誉损失、客户流失等。通过分析攻击数据,可以估算出攻击导致的经济损失。
#### 3.1.3 安全投入回报率
安全投入回报率是评估安全投资效果的重要指标。通过分析攻击数据,可以评估安全措施的有效性,从而优化安全资源配置,提高投入回报率。
### 3.2 影响评估方法
#### 3.2.1 定量评估
定量评估主要通过数值化的指标来评估攻击影响。例如,使用统计分析方法,计算业务中断时间、经济损失等指标的均值、方差等统计量。
#### 3.2.2 定性评估
定性评估主要通过专家经验和主观判断来评估攻击影响。例如,组织安全专家进行风险评估,结合攻击数据分析结果,给出综合评估意见。
#### 3.2.3 模拟仿真
模拟仿真通过构建虚拟环境,模拟攻击场景,评估攻击影响。例如,使用仿真软件,模拟不同攻击场景下的业务运行情况,评估攻击对业务的影响。
## 四、解决方案与建议
### 4.1 建立完善的攻击数据分析体系
- **数据采集**:建立全面的数据采集机制,确保数据的完整性和实时性。
- **数据分析**:引入AI技术,提升数据分析的效率和准确性。
- **结果应用**:将分析结果应用于安全策略优化、应急响应等环节。
### 4.2 加强AI技术在攻击数据分析中的应用
- **算法优化**:不断优化AI算法,提高攻击模式识别和趋势预测的准确性。
- **模型训练**:加强模型训练,提升AI模型的泛化能力和适应性。
- **系统集成**:将AI技术与现有安全系统集成,实现自动化、智能化的攻击数据分析。
### 4.3 建立科学的评估机制
- **指标体系**:建立全面的评估指标体系,涵盖业务中断时间、经济损失、安全投入回报率等多个维度。
- **评估方法**:综合运用定量评估、定性评估和模拟仿真等多种方法,提高评估的全面性和准确性。
- **持续改进**:根据评估结果,不断优化攻击数据分析体系,提升其对业务的保障能力。
### 4.4 提升安全团队的专业能力
- **培训教育**:加强安全团队的专业培训,提升其对AI技术和攻击数据分析的理解和应用能力。
- **人才引进**:引进具有AI和网络安全背景的专业人才,充实安全团队的技术力量。
- **协作机制**:建立跨部门、跨领域的协作机制,提升安全团队的协同作战能力。
## 五、案例分析
### 5.1 案例背景
某大型电商平台近年来频繁遭受网络攻击,导致业务中断和客户数据泄露,严重影响了平台的正常运营和声誉。为应对这一问题,该平台引入了AI技术进行攻击数据分析,并建立了相应的评估机制。
### 5.2 解决方案
#### 5.2.1 数据采集与分析
该平台部署了多种数据采集工具,实时收集网络流量、日志文件等数据。利用AI技术进行数据预处理和攻击模式识别,及时发现异常行为和潜在攻击。
#### 5.2.2 攻击趋势预测
通过时间序列分析和关联规则挖掘,预测未来一段时间内的攻击趋势,提前采取防御措施。
#### 5.2.3 影响评估
建立全面的评估指标体系,涵盖业务中断时间、经济损失、安全投入回报率等指标。综合运用定量评估、定性评估和模拟仿真等方法,评估攻击对业务的影响。
### 5.3 实施效果
通过引入AI技术和建立科学的评估机制,该平台的攻击防范能力显著提升,业务中断时间和经济损失大幅减少,安全投入回报率显著提高。
## 结论
攻击数据分析对业务的保障作用至关重要。通过引入AI技术,可以提升攻击数据分析的效率和准确性,科学评估其对业务的影响,从而优化安全策略,提升业务的安全性和稳定性。未来,随着AI技术的不断发展和应用,攻击数据分析将在网络安全领域发挥更加重要的作用。
## 参考文献
1. 张三, 李四. 网络安全中的攻击数据分析技术研究[J]. 计算机科学与技术, 2020, 35(4): 123-130.
2. 王五, 赵六. 基于AI的网络安全攻击趋势预测方法[J]. 信息安全研究, 2019, 29(2): 45-52.
3. 陈七, 刘八. 网络攻击影响评估方法及其应用[J]. 网络安全技术, 2021, 40(1): 78-85.
---
本文通过对攻击数据分析的概述、AI技术在其中的应用、影响评估方法及解决方案的详细探讨,旨在为企业和组织提供一套科学、系统的评估方法和实践指导,助力其在网络安全领域取得更好的成效。